To learn more about our Service department please view the link below: Chapman Ford, Northeast Philadelphia PA Compensation and Benefits: In addition to competitive pay, we offer our associates: Health insurance with choice of medical plans starting at $84.50/monthDental and vision insuranceLife, STD, LTD, Hospital Indemnity, Accident, and Critical Illness Insurance401(k) retirement investment plan with company matchAccrued paid time offEmployee Vehicle Purchase ProgramParts and service discountsProfessional work environment, with job training and advancement opportunities Responsibilities Meet and greet service customers promptly in a professional and courteous manner.Inspect vehicle and refer to service history to accurately identify and verify customer's service needs.Provide leadership to your team.Promote the sales of appropriate services, parts, and accessories by thoroughly understanding the product and associated service requirements.Provide accurate cost and time of completion estimates for the services recommended, communicate and get proper authorization from customers.Check on progress of services to vehicles throughout the day and contact customer to communicate and receive approval regarding any changes in the cost-estimate, promised time of delivery or recommended services.Administer new and used vehicle warranty repairs in accordance with manufacturer warranty guidelines.Confirm service appointments by telephone the day before the customer is scheduled to arrive and conduct post-repair follow up.Inspect vehicles prior to each customer delivery to ensure vehicles services and/or repairs are performed correctly and communicate the results with the customer.Meet requirements of the state and federal law for automobile repair and consumer protection.Demonstrates behaviors consistent with the Company's Values in all interactions with customers, co-workers and vendors.
